Detailed Description

An instance of the built-in RegExp constructor (ECMA-262, 15.10).

Definition at line 19 of file v8-regexp.h.

Member Enumeration Documentation

◆ Flags

Regular expression flag bits. They can be or'ed to enable a set of flags. The kLinear value ('l') is experimental and can only be used with –enable-experimental-regexp-engine. RegExps with kLinear flag are guaranteed to be executed in asymptotic linear time wrt. the length of the subject string.

◆ Exec()

MaybeLocal< v8::Object > v8::RegExp::Exec ( Local< Context > context,
Local< String > subject )

Executes the current RegExp instance on the given subject string. Equivalent to RegExp.prototype.exec as described in

https://tc39.es/ecma262/#sec-regexp.prototype.exec

On success, an Array containing the matched strings is returned. On failure, returns Null.

Note: modifies global context state, accessible e.g. through RegExp.input.

◆ New()

MaybeLocal< v8::RegExp > v8::RegExp::New ( Local< Context > context,
Local< String > pattern,
Flags flags )
static

Creates a regular expression from the given pattern string and the flags bit field. May throw a JavaScript exception as described in ECMA-262, 15.10.4.1.

For example, RegExp::New(v8::String::New("foo"), static_cast<RegExp::Flags>(kGlobal | kMultiline)) is equivalent to evaluating "/foo/gm".

◆ NewWithBacktrackLimit()

MaybeLocal< v8::RegExp > v8::RegExp::NewWithBacktrackLimit ( Local< Context > context,
Local< String > pattern,
Flags flags,
uint32_t backtrack_limit )
static

Like New, but additionally specifies a backtrack limit. If the number of backtracks done in one Exec call hits the limit, a match failure is immediately returned.
